Pillar is a Grammy-nominated Christian rock band that was formed in 1998.
Description:
Pillar originally started with playing in a rapcore style, and has since moved more to a hard rock sound. The band has at least ten full length albums and they were voted Best Hard Rock Band in CCM Magazine's 2006 Reader's Choice Award. Pillar has played at both Cornerstone Festival and Creation Festival. It was revealed at Soulfest 2007 that the name of their next project would be For the Love of the Game, which was eventually released on February 26, 2008. The band members – Rob Beckley, Noah Henson, Lester Estelle Jr., and Kalel (AKA Michael Wittig) – explain on their website “the apostle known as Paul probably never could have imagined that one day, 21 centuries after he lived, a band called Pillar would deliver the very same message of Christ’s love that he did—this time around via the incendiary crunch of distorted power chords paired with roaring vocals, over the cacophony of crashing drums and the bone-rattling thump of the bass”.
